JUDGMENT / ORDER

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ned Standing Counsel for the Kerala State Road Transport Corporation, apart from perusing the record. Since the issue lies in a narrow compass, this Court proposes to dispose of the writ petition at the admission stage itself. 2. Briefly stated, the petitioner, Driver Grade I, was initially working in Cherthala Depot of the respondent Corporation. The petitioner is said to be a heart patient undergoing intensive treatment since 2006. In proof of the treatment he has been undergoing, the petitioner places on record Exts.P1 to P3 medical certificates. Presently, the petitioner has been transferred to Mavelikkara Depot through Ext.P5 transfer order. Aggrieved thereby, the petitioner is said to have submitted Ext.P6 representation before the first respondent seeking transfer back to Cherthala. For expeditious disposal of Ext.P6 representation, the W.P.(C.) No. 33306/2014 -2-
petitioner has filed the present writ petition.
3. The lear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the petitioner has been suffering from acute heart disorder and he needs constant medical attention. According to him, at the place where he was working earlier i.e., the Cherthala Depot, the petitioner could have the requisite medical facility.
Be that as it may, in the facts and circumstances, having regard to the respective submissions of the learned Counsel for the petitioner and the learned Standing Counsel, this Court, without expressing any opinion on the merits of the matter, disposes of the writ petition with a direction to the first respondent to consider the petitioner's Ext.P6 representation in accordance with law and pass appropriate orders thereon, as expeditiously as possible, at any rate, within eight we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this judgment. No order as to costs.
sd/- DAMA SESHADRI NAIDU, JUDGE.
